Outline of Final Research Achievements

Genetic analysis of important traits in Chrysanthemum has not progressed due to polyploidy and self-incompatibility. Our group isolated the self-compatible mutant line AEV02 from the genetic resources of Chrysanthemum seticuspe. To determine the molecular function of Csc1, a single recessive locus that determines self-compatibility in AEV02, we performed genetic analysis using the recently determined genome sequence of Gojo-0. As a result of genetic analysis using segregating populations, the candidate genomic region was redefined but 862 kb of the previously narrowed genomic region was excluded. In the redefined genomic region, an LTR-type retrotransposon was inserted into an LRK gene, which was highly expressed in the style. We considered it a candidate for an important causative gene and are undergoing transformation experiments. In addition, genetic analysis of whether the Csc1 gene is an S gene or a modifier gene revealed that Csc1 acts as an S gene.
